Fun Longisquama Facts For Kids

One of the mysterious reptiles that belonged to the middle and late Triassic period that spanned from 247 to 201 million years ago (mya), the Longisquama is a genus that consisted of a single species called the Longisquama insignia. The reptile must have become extinct somewhere between Norian and Rhaetian ages. The term Longisquama is a combination of two Latin words: ’longus’ and ‘squama’ which mean ’long’ and ‘scales’, respectively. Fun Luna Moth Facts For Kids

The luna moth (Actias luna) is one of the larger moths belonging exclusively to North America. In Canada, this species can be found in Central Quebec and the Nova Scotia region. Further south, in the United States, luna moths are seen from Maine to Florida. Adult luna moths are seen in forest and woodland areas.In the year 1700, James Petiver described and named this species as Phalena plumata caudata. Fun Sandhill Crane Facts For Kids

Sandhill crane (Antigone Canadensis) are large cranes inhabiting North America and northeastern Siberia. In North America, Sandhill cranes have six subspecies. The migratory cranes are greater Sandhill cranes, lesser Sandhill cranes, and the Canadian sandhill cranes. The Florida sandhill cranes, Mississippi sandhill cranes, and Cuban sandhill cranes are non-migratory birds.Each of the sandhill crane subspecies usually nests in the open, wet grassland habitats within their range. Fun Sperm Whale Facts For Kids

The Sperm Whale (Physeter macrocephalus) also recognized as Cachalot is the biggest of the toothed whales and the only existing branch of the Physeter (genus). Sperm Whales are also among the three living lineages of the family of Sperm Whales which involves two other species as well namely the Pygmy Sperm Whale and Dwarf Sperm Whale.The Sperm Whale’s geographic range is vast.
